Essentials: Course: Cuisine: Ingredients: Sauce: Preparation: Mix 3 parts Moore's Teriyaki Marinade to 1 part ketchup. Smoke ribs according to smokers instructions. Remove ribs from smoker and apply teriyaki / ketchup glaze to ribs with barbecue brush. Add sesame seeds and chopped green onion for garnish. Chop and serve immediately.

Mix soy sauce and sugar together in a microwave-safe bowl and microwave on high for 2 minutes. Stir in onion, sesame seeds, sesame oil, garlic, and ginger. Slice pork into 1/4-inch cutlets and place in a marinating pan or dish, spreading out evenly. Pour the marinade over the pork and refrigerate for at least 4 to 5 hours; overnight is better.
